[LINUX] Problems compiling crystalhd branch - Printable Version +- Kodi Community Forum (https://forum.kodi.tv) +-- Forum: Development (https://forum.kodi.tv/forumdisplay.php?fid=32) +--- Forum: Kodi Application (https://forum.kodi.tv/forumdisplay.php?fid=93) +--- Thread: [LINUX] Problems compiling crystalhd branch (/showthread.php?tid=62708) |
- i5Js - 2010-01-02 dan1son Wrote:Still having slow ethernet problems. Not sure what else to try. Maybe upgrading the kernel manually or even running ubuntu 9.10 (assuming all of this stuff works on that). I've this proccess too... Is there any way to disable it? Because when I kill it, it apears again. - TeknoJnky - 2010-01-02 ok trying to get the driver/lib installed dan1son Wrote:If you download the source from broadcom http://www.broadcom.com/support/crystal_hd/ Code: xbmc@appletv:~$ dos2unix crystalhd/driver/linux/* crystalhd/linux_lib/libcrystalhd/* crystalhd/include/* crystalhd/include/link/* even tried with sudo same Quote:Download davilla's patch posted a page or two ago. Put it in your home directory and type 'patch -p0 < patchfilename' Code: xbmc@appletv:~$ patch -p0 < davillapatch I assume from the error above. I'll keep re-reading the thread incase I missed another post. - davilla - 2010-01-02 the official Broadcom released source code is now mirrored at Code: http://code.google.com/p/crystalhd-for-osx/source/browse/#svn/trunk/crystalhd This svn also contains the line ending fixes, udev patches and anything else I have found so far. It's intended as the upstream osx kext/lib location but the Linux driver/lib are also contained here. Note that osx kext/lib is not up yet, getting there - i5Js - 2010-01-03 Downloaded, compiled, installed and working, but xmbc doesn't... There is no support to crystalhd... - cj43 - 2010-01-03 i5Js Wrote:Downloaded, compiled, installed and working, but XBMC doesn't... There is no support to crystalhd... Sounds like the module isn't loaded. Is crystalhd listed when you do a lsmod? If it is, then go ahead and try forcing xbmc to use the crystalHD render method: System -> Video -> Playback -> Render method. I saw sdavilla just added the auto detect code for render method a day or so ago. If it isn't listed in lsmod, run the bcm_70012_run.sh script to get it to load. If you are using the code from the code.google.com web page that sdavilla pointed to above, copy "20-crystalhd.rules" to "/etc/udev/rules.d/" so the module will load after a reboot. - i5Js - 2010-01-03 Thanks for the answer.. aTV:~/post-install/crystalhd$ lsmod Module Size Used by crystalhd 47400 0 I think the module is loaded, but there is no support when I run ./configure --enable-crystalhd, I don't no why... Thanks anyway. - cj43 - 2010-01-03 i5Js Wrote:Thanks for the answer.. Ok, didn't know you were still compiling. Do you have /usr/include/libcrystalhd with these files in it: bc_dts_defs.h bc_dts_types.h libcrystalhd_if.h ? If so, I would question the branch or version of code you have checked out. Your using trunk and not the old crystalHD branch? - i5Js - 2010-01-03 grrr i'm using the old crystalhd branch!!!!! I'm stupid!!!! so, I have to checkout from https://xbmc.svn.sourceforge.net/svnroot/xbmc/trunk/ ? BR - cj43 - 2010-01-03 i5Js Wrote:grrr i'm using the old crystalhd branch!!!!! I'm stupid!!!!Yep, should compile then. svn checkout https://xbmc.svn.sourceforge.net/svnroot/xbmc/trunk XBMCtrunk - i5Js - 2010-01-03 At last!!! ------------------------ XBMC Configuration: ------------------------ Debugging: Yes Profiling: No Optimization: Yes OpenGL: Yes VDPAU: Yes CrystalHD: Yes Thank you very very much cj43!. Compiling right now. - i5Js - 2010-01-03 Finally compiled and installed, but I still having issues watching 1080p movies, this is "the pastebin" http://pastebin.com/m47c8da44 BR - cj43 - 2010-01-03 i5Js Wrote:Finally compiled and installed, but I still having issues watching 1080p movies, this is "the pastebin" I've seen the same issues on my build. Hopefully Davilla will figure out what is causing it and fix it when he gets a chance. Iam trying some older builds to see if they have the same problems. - davilla - 2010-01-03 i5Js Wrote:Finally compiled and installed, but I still having issues watching 1080p movies, this is "the pastebin" Your build looks old, can't tell since you clipped the log. but I see Creating YUV NPOT texture of size and svn@26268 has Creating NV12 POT texture of size My pastebin - cj43 - 2010-01-03 Here is my xbmc.log. Same problem other people are reporting in this thread with playing 1080p. Seems to be something that started when it went to trunk and/or the switch to the official drivers. Here is the mediainfo if that will help. Basically I just see the following lines over and over in the log while the video stutters: DEBUG: CrystalHD: SetDropState... 0 DEBUG: CrystalHD: SetDropState... 1 - davilla - 2010-01-03 cj43 Wrote:Here is my xbmc.log. Same problem other people are reporting in this thread with playing 1080p. Seems to be something that started when it went to trunk and/or the switch to the official drivers. Here is the mediainfo if that will help. try killing PulseAudio, I've never had good luck running it. It does strange things. quit xbmc, "pulseaudio -k" on the command-line. |